## Marketing Budget Cut — Managers Only

Quick heads-up for the board: we're trimming the Brellix Foods marketing spend by about 18% for the back half of the year. The Sundrift campaign stays, but the Pineharbor regional push gets shelved until Q2. Tova Lindqvist's team has already reworked the channel mix, so reach shouldn't drop as much as the raw numbers suggest. Please keep this off general channels. The strategic reasoning is summarised below.

management briefing: The renewal with Quenathox Group closes at $10 million a year, 20 percent below the last contract. Project Ulawyn slips by two quarters because of the supplier delay.

TURN-208: Gatevale turnstile counters at the Merrow Field pilot double-count when a rotation reverses mid-cycle. Attendance totals drift roughly 2% high per event. The debounce window fix is implemented, reviewed by Ilsa, and soak-tested across two simulated match days without drift. Ready for your cut; the candidate build is identified below.

trace token, tagag-tafog: htk6_5ed18c

Defaults changed for the nightly catalogue import feeding the Ashgrove branch system. Batch size is reduced to avoid lock contention on the holdings table, the retry backoff is now exponential rather than fixed, and malformed MARC-style records are quarantined instead of aborting the run. Existing cron schedules are unaffected. Release manager: please confirm downstream consumers can tolerate the later completion time before tagging. The new default values shipping with this release are as follows.

deployment values, faduf-tawep:
SORDOR_LOG_LEVEL=error
SORDOR_METRICS_HOST=metrics.sordor.nelvrolabs.internal
SORDOR_POOL_SIZE=4

INTERNAL MEMO

To: Sales Leads
From: Marta Evelund, Commercial Finance
Re: Gross-Margin Review — Q3

The quarterly gross-margin review for the Corvid platform is complete. Margins slipped 1.8 points, driven mainly by discounting on mid-tier renewals in the Halverton region. Effective next cycle, deals below 32% margin require sign-off from Commercial Finance before quoting. Please brief your teams before Friday. The strategic context for this tightening is summarised below.

internal memo for kawip-hadug: Headcount on the Wenwyn team goes from 7 to 140 by the end of January. Gross margin on Wenwyn came in at 20 percent against a plan of 15 percent.